Crispy Lemon Herb Roasted Chicken Thighs with Roasted Broccoli
Savor this delightful dish featuring tender, skinless chicken thighs roasted to perfection with a zesty lemon herb marinade, paired with brightly flavored, crispy roasted broccoli. A light yet satisfying meal that's perfect for any time of day.
INGREDIENTS
2 pieces Chicken Thigh (Skinless) (~200g total)
150g Broccoli
1 teaspo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il
2 tablespoons Lemon Juice
2 cloves Garlic
1 teaspoon Fresh Thyme
1 teaspoon Fresh Rosemary
Salt and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
In a small bowl, combine the lemon juice, minced garlic, fresh thyme, fresh rosemary, salt, and pepper.
Place the chicken thighs in a bowl and pour half of the lemon herb mixture over them. Toss to coat evenly and let marinate for at least 15 minutes.
Meanwhile, toss the broccoli florets in a bowl with the olive oil, remaining lemon herb mixture, salt, and pepper until evenly seasoned.
Arrange the chicken thighs on a baking sheet and roast in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es until cooked through and slightly crispy on the edges.
On a separate baking sheet or alongside the chicken if space allows, spread out the broccoli in a single layer. Roast for about 15-20 minutes until they are tender with crispy edges.
Serve the roasted chicken thighs with a generous side of roasted broccoli. Enjoy your healthy, protein-packed meal!
